Type
ORACLE
Validation date
2025-01-23 20:50: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01448,
    "usd": 0.01508
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010311409D377755CA6296FFD1541337A6CEA2449825F1BBA6D0D66BE9F9915177

Previous signature

47B53988E35834CD4CE48BD495314B825D1949FA3DA829B0B0E838F834D40567D65264F75E54DE0E11DA6D7261C74940235BA7EF95F088CF471E3A01681A190D

Origin signature

304402207C1381DE52A89742BAB8E88F541A1D7B19E142432091D60AB896084BA509075302202227EB22C0222A92BFC81C570AB09AB6C967F09C1862F752EDB654CCAF07DCA1

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0036E12B2C9722B72302D968F04E2D8D4AA0199A84E8AF96D148EE1003B73A8C8F

Coordinator signature

D7EB5E58FF1F664E60353E84B92875AC49ECC7BEB3705AFC2CFBB544ADFF1596B468F43CBAC3FE0A449F0F3C91181718A4E4223E645E62EF4539320B29401D01

Validator #1 public key

0001A6201599712BCE8837B0E841A875DF0042FA049626A0CF674EFA574BDCDA3221

Validator #1 signature

99F157539BCCD9808C4891BDD60D7D4414073CF6B2F37711208505F8479B4822EC9939244C64D5A80F4A7266A0BADEC834D2ED017E00A8926B9A41918AE21D02

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

07A7F709613BBCA3834670C20E286783BF04D5309633FA4635F897F50B8DCF4E5F8D3504CAAC5E04133E82CF01382C8C0E5A71481A7F1EF457A232F6C076DF06